What is a Flow Cytometry Test for Minimal Residual Disease (MRD) in T-ALL?

The flow cytometry test for MRD in T-ALL uses a method called flow cytometry to detect tiny numbers of leukaemia cells remaining in the bone marrow after treatment. It is ordered for patients diagnosed with T-cell acute lymphoblastic leukaemia (T-ALL), a cancer of immature white blood cells. Also called MRD flow cytometry for T-ALL or the T-ALL MRD Panel, this test is far more sensitive than a standard microscopic examination. A Bone marrow aspirate/peripheral blood sample is collected for analysis.

What Does a Flow Cytometry Test for MRD in T-ALL Measure?

This test identifies and counts any abnormal T-cells (leukaemia cells) still present in the bone marrow after treatment begins. The following markers and measurements are analysed:

ParameterWhat It Shows
Leukaemia-associated immunophenotypes (LAIPs)Abnormal patterns of cell surface markers unique to the original leukaemia clone
T-cell surface markers (CD2, CD3, CD4, CD5, CD7, CD8, CD10, CD34, CD45, CD48, CD56, CD99, HLA-DR)Specific proteins on cell surfaces that help identify and distinguish residual leukaemia cells
Residual T-lymphoblast percentageProportion of abnormal T-cells remaining, expressed as a percentage of all nucleated cells
MRD statusClassified as positive (at or above 0.01%) or negative (below 0.01%)

Why is a Flow Cytometry Test for MRD in T-ALL Done?

This test plays an important role in understanding how well T-ALL treatment is working and whether leukaemia cells remain after therapy.

Conditions This Test Can Help Detect

  • Measuring treatment response after chemotherapy
  • Detecting residual leukaemia cells that remain even when standard tests show remission
  • Assessing the risk of disease returning (relapse)
  • Guiding decisions about further treatment, including stem cell transplantation

Flow Cytometry Test for MRD in T-ALL for Chronic Disease Monitoring

MRD testing is a key part of ongoing T-ALL management. It is typically performed at several points during treatment: at the end of induction therapy (around Day 29), after consolidation therapy, and before or after stem cell transplantation. Patients with a positive MRD result at any of these points may have their treatment plan modified to reduce the risk of relapse.

Step-by-Step Procedure

Here is what to expect:

Bone marrow aspirate

The bone marrow aspirate for this test is collected by a trained medical professional in a clinical setting.

  • You will be asked to lie on your side or stomach; most samples are taken from the back of the hip bone (iliac crest).
  • The skin over the area is cleaned, and a local anaesthetic (numbing medicine) is injected into the skin and the surface of the bone.
  • A special needle is inserted into the bone, and a small amount of bone marrow fluid is drawn out using suction.
  • The sample is collected in a sodium heparin (green-top) tube; approximately 3 mL is required.
  • The needle is removed, pressure is applied to the site, and a bandage is placed over it.

Peripheral blood

If a peripheral blood sample is advised, a healthcare professional will draw blood from a vein in your arm using a sterile needle and collection tube.

  • After collection, the puncture site is covered with a small dressing.
  • The sample is stored at 2 to 8°C and sent to the laboratory promptly for processing.

Factors That Can Affect Accuracy

The following factors can influence the reliability of your MRD test result:

  • Haemodilution (blood mixing with the bone marrow sample), which can cause an underestimation of residual leukaemia cells.
  • Delayed sample handling; cells must reach the laboratory within 48 hours of collection for best results.
  • Inadequate sample volume or poor cell quality.
  • Using the wrong anticoagulant in the collection tube.
  • Changes in marker expression due to prior treatment can affect how cells are identified.

Understanding Your Flow Cytometry Test for MRD in T-ALL Results

Your results will be reviewed by a haematologist or oncologist, along with your treatment history and clinical condition. The table below gives a general guide to what MRD levels mean:

MRD LevelResultInterpretation
Less than 0.01% (or undetectable)NegativeNo detectable residual leukaemia cells; suggests a good response to treatment
0.01% or abovePositiveResidual leukaemia cells are present, which may indicate a higher risk of relapse

These ranges are general guidelines. Your doctor will interpret your results based on your age, health history, and other factors. Always consult a qualified healthcare professional for personalised medical advice.

Results During Special Conditions

Certain factors can affect how results are read:

  • Haemodilution of the bone marrow sample can make the cell count appear lower than it actually is, which may lead to a false-negative result.
  • Delayed handling of the sample causes cells to deteriorate, altering their surface marker patterns and making accurate classification more difficult.
  • Treatment itself can alter the expression of key markers such as CD3, CD4, CD5, CD7, and CD45, which must be accounted for in the analysis.

Complete remission means no leukaemia cells are visible under a microscope, typically fewer than 5% blasts in the bone marrow. The MRD test is far more sensitive and can detect as few as one leukaemia cell among 10,000 normal cells. A patient can be in remission by standard criteria but still have a positive MRD result.
